There are a few micromanagement aids I think could be very useful and still require playing the game.
1) Having the ability to say goto point (x,y) could be very useful. You could even restrict the system to only allow (x,y) to be a line from the current point.) You are not having the computer do the work for you, it just gives you a little more flexibility in the long term commands.
2) Having the ability to jump to or see a list of units which don't have commands would also be very helpful. It easy (esp. on the large boards) to lose units or to forget about a plan you hatched at 3am.
3) A standard usage with CTs is to make a base, move off the base and then set a full attack for the rest of movement, since you can't build a unit if the CT is on the base. It would be nice if there was a way to automate this (a good interface does not spring to mind, but your interfaces are excellent johnny, so I'm hoping you have a good idea).
1) this is perpetual in a nutshell. you just don't get to set a point to stop you just go till you hit something. I think very little distinction between the 2 there.
2) I agree with this one. just a cycle through idle units button or a menu option very similar to battle log that as you mouse over your idle units poof you pop over too them.
3) there isn't really a clever fix from Johnny's (that comes to my mind) but if you put move on HotKey this becomes a 2 click move (minus actually build the base). I personally recommend M.
